Septoplasty in Florida: Common Questions
What is the average price of septoplasty in Florida?
Florida patients pay an average of $5,216 for septoplasty. Quotes from individual providers generally fall between $3,009 and $10,030, with facility fees and surgeon experience accounting for most of the variation.
Will my health insurance pay for septoplasty?
Some insurance plans cover septoplasty, but only when there's a documented medical reason. Cosmetic cases are almost never covered. If you're in Florida, get a pre-authorization determination before committing to a provider.
When can I return to work after septoplasty?
Most Florida patients need 7 to 21 days to fully recover from septoplasty. Your surgeon will schedule follow-ups during this window to monitor healing. How do I compare septoplasty facilities in Florida?
Start with case volume — facilities that perform more procedures generally have better outcomes. In Florida, also compare hospital vs. ambulatory surgery center pricing (ASCs can be 30-50% cheaper) and check whether your insurance network includes the facility.

Does Florida Medicaid cover septoplasty?
If septoplasty is deemed medically necessary, Florida's Medicaid program may cover it partially or fully. You'll need your doctor to submit documentation to your plan. Elective cases without a medical justification are generally not covered.
